Lac-Saguay
Lac Saguay, located in Lac-Saguay in the Laurentides region, is a popular fishing destination known for its Muskellunge and Arctic char. On June 8th, the municipality hosts a fishing festival where you can fish without a permit, making it a perfect opportunity to introduce children to the sport.
